Rivian officer plans sale of 15,000 shares
An executive of Rivian Automotive filed a Rule 144 notice to sell up to 15,000 shares of common stock.
Rhea-AI Filing Summary
Rivian Automotive, Inc. (RIVN) received a Rule 144 notice that officer Michael J. Callahan intends to sell up to 15,000 shares of Rivian common stock. The shares are to be sold through Morgan Stanley Smith Barney LLC on NASDAQ, with an approximate aggregate market value of $244,390.50.

Rule 144 regulatory
"See the definition of "person" in paragraph (a) of Rule 144."
Rule 144 is a U.S. securities regulation that sets conditions under which restricted or insider-held shares can be legally resold to the public, such as required holding periods, availability of public information, limits on how much can be sold at once, and certain filing requirements. For investors it matters because it determines when previously locked-up shares can enter the market — like a release valve that can increase supply, affect share price, and signal insider intent.
restricted stock financial
"Common | 08/15/2023 | Restricted Stock | ISSUER"
Shares granted to an individual that carry limits on transfer or sale until certain conditions are met, such as staying with the company for a set time or hitting performance targets. Think of them as a locked gift that gradually opens; for investors they matter because they affect how many shares may enter the market later, signal management incentives and potential dilution, and reveal confidence in future company performance.
